Do You Need Water Damage Restoration?
If flooding has occurred in your home after a hurricane, storm, or when extinguishing a fire then you probably have extensive water damage. This is a very serious problem and there are other issues involved. To save yourself future headaches you should do something about this situation immediately. If in the long run you want to save money, then your only alternative is to hire specialist in the field of water damage restoration.
Water damage comes under three different categories. Was it clean water from water lines? Was it contaminated water or gray water? And then the last category, which is the worst, did it come from sewage, which is considered black water.
If you do not react quickly you may have very serious problems that would affect the value of your home. Water is not the only damage that you will experience. Since everything is damp there will be mold and mildew growing especially in those areas that you cannot see.
Mold cannot form if the area is dry so you must quickly take care of this. If this is not remedied immediately it can be a serious health hazard. Bacteria can grow within hours so those with respiratory ailments can be seriously affected.
The extent of the mold must be identified. This is done by using specialized equipment. There are special techniques used in removing the mold so as not to disturb the spores and cause a greater problem.
First of all remove all the water, dry the house, and if there was continuation sanitize. Again, professionals use special equipment for these steps to move air and dehumidify. These accelerate the process of drying, which is vital. When water has all been extracted then the damaged areas are cleaned. There is a proper manner in which to do this. You may think that your carpet is dry when you touch it but that may not be the case.
Testing the house should be done to evaluate if everything is dry and if not, what is the remaining moisture content. The water may have caused damage to your furniture, personal items, or the worst possible scenario, structural damage. Thermal imaging cameras are used to evaluate the extent of damage and moisture.
In monitoring the progress of the effectiveness of the work and equipment it can be determined which areas need more attention. Possibly one area was more damaged than another and this must be remedied. As the work is completed and deemed a safe environment according to industry standards, then restoration was a success.
Whatever it may have been that cause this damage it is best left to the professionals. Without the proper equipment and expertise it may not be safe or effective to do this yourself. The technician knows exactly what to investigate and what equipment to use. Your home may be damaged beyond repair and the decrease in value may be enormous. Reasons To Employ A Real Estate Attorney For The Purchase Of A Home
Purchasing a home or other type of real estate is a sizable financial investment. Making any mistakes during the process can be costly, both in terms of money and your time.
For most folks, all the legal claptrap that comes with buying property is way beyond them. This is why it is advisable to get legal advice so that you do not end up with a significant error that you will regret.
While a real estate attorney can provide a buyer with many different services, the most noteworthy is of course the fact that he or she will be able to review the purchase contract before anything is finalized.
A lawyer will also review any other documents that are important to the purchasing process, such as the deed, the title, mortgage loan documents, insurance policies, plat of survey, and any relevant bills of sale that are associated with the sales process. A careful legal review of these kinds of documents will catch any errors such as misspelled names or legal description mistakes that could cause problems during the sales transaction.
Although it varies by state in regards to what a real estate attorney can do, in most cases an attorney can revise the language of a purchase contract if necessary. An attorney can also void a purchase contract that doesn't meet state law requirements. If there are unpaid expenses such as property taxes or utility bills that should be paid to you by the seller, an attorney can help negotiate the payment of these expenses.
Keep in mind that no real estate attorney will offer their services free of charge, so you will need to set aside some funds for their services. Of course, this is money well spent, as it ensures the buyer is protected from any costly errors.
Having a real estate attorney will give you freedom, as you will not feel so tied down by the worry and stress you may experience from trying to complete legal documents. The fewer worries the buyer has to put up with the better.
Just ensure you understand all the fees associated with the real estate attorney, otherwise you could end up spending more than you wanted to.

Getting To Know The Buyers And The Sellers Market
Real estate property brokers throughout the state know precisely what type of market we are in. But as being a amateur home purchaser and also someone that just doesn't pay that much thought to the present housing pattern, a buyers or sellers market might be complicated to them. What kinds of market do each of these benefit and how to recognize which we are in now?
The phrase alone can help offer some insight into what the market means. A consumers market likely to be geared more in relation to buyers where as a seller's market concerning sellers. But how does that influence one or the other parties involved in a real estate deal? Let's analyze the two to find an idea of what each actually implies.
BUYERS MARKET - A buyers market usually implies one wherein the customer has the superiority. You will discover usually more houses available on the market than there are buyers therefore the buyer has the top of the heap so to speak and usually at a good price. Buyers markets usually possess good choice of residences, land and properties for sale and sellers are more likely to give a positive response offers regardless how low.
Buyers usually might get bank-possessed residences, less than market value homes and properties, and acquire sellers to complete just about everything. If there is a seller hesitating to change on cost or repairs, there is a seller down the street ready to give in. Buyers absolutely possess the major advantage in this market but it really also relies upon on the interest rates. Rates can diverge and even if there are tons of properties available, there still can be a huge interest rate keeping buyers from being able to come up with the money for these homes.
Sellers have quite a duty in this market. This isn't the list today, sold tomorrow form of market. Sellers must be serious to place their home on the market in this subject. Sellers usually won't get what the home is worth and will probably ought to skip through several hoops to have the deal concluded. Homes can and do sell during this time but at what cost is really the subject for the seller.
SELLERS MARKET - A sellers market is the converse where one can find numerous buyers and not an adequate amount of homes to be sold. From approximately 2002 - 2005 there was a tremendous bubble that eventually burst around 2007. There were just not enough homes to maintain on the market before they were sold. Clients were snatching up homes left and right and even putting in bids for homes greater than the selling price with escalation clauses explaining they would pay so much above the highest proposal. It was effortless to market a home and most homes bought within a month of being listed if they were anywhere reasonably charged.
Buyers had excellent rates of interest and the subprime mortgage trend was in full swing. It was easy to buy and everyone was. The dilemma is that when the interest rates came due, all those buyers couldn't pay for the mortgage anymore, and that bubble caused the issues we are in at the present with a lot of house in foreclosure and short sales. These same clients that took advantage of very expensive homes and easy mortgages back then are the same sellers or borrowers moving out of those homes.
Every market has it's peaks and valleys. Each has pros and cons. The secret is finding out when to promote and when to buy. Not all clients buy at the right time and not all sellers sell at the right time. For investors, this timing is crucial. They have to recognize the current market and investigate the developments painstakingly.

Effectively Planning A Renovation Project
When redesigning an interior space or home, the proper tools are often essential to see that the job is done effectively and within your budget. You may want to pay for the services of an expert builder who will be able to confirm that the plans for your dwelling are adequate and easily obtainable. As such, when you face planning a renovation project, there are a number of elements to take into consideration.
Pricing is often the most critical part to influence the extent of the overhaul. An unlimited budget may present greater options for the renovation but even smaller finances can be used accordingly, if the planning is done well.
Many times, an architect may help you in the redesign of the space as you have it in mind. This qualified person could help you draw up the necessary plans and have them approved in your district. Depending on what you want overhauled, the plans may state all that will need to be done, including breaking down existing walls, adding new doors and window frames or even redirecting the entire purpose of a room.
The foundation of an existing area is important in the renovations as this is often the hardest part to redesign. Often times, builders use the existing ground level to rebuild a different area or may build on to the current foundation to offer extensions to a current dwelling. If the space around your plot permits it, you could even be able to branch outwards and extend the flow of your space.
In many instances for those undertaking to build upwards, the consent of neighbors is regularly required. For new double storey structures, the surrounding homes should be alerted to the fact that this may affect the amount of sunlight they will get into their homes. Once nearby resident approve of your plans you could begin to develop the designs of constructing a staircase leading upwards. In this case, the entire roof will also have to be raised to make for greater living spaces on a new floor.
Sometimes it is possible to remain in the house while renovations are taking place. However, depending on the amount of work that needs to be done and the safety issues that could surface, the home owners may be obliged to move out of the present home for a period in order to complete the basic restoration. This will need to be considered early enough when the initial plans are being put up. If reflected on at the start of your project planning, you might be able to make other living arrangements way in advance of the building schedule.
Building on to your home may initially be an overwhelming thought. It could also take much effort, time and finances, but often times, the rewards of living in a renovated space can outweigh all the negative aspects. You may want to make a list of pro and con alternatives to help you decide what will be best in your situation.
In conclusion, the general design of a space can be the determining factor in planning a renovation project. You may want to consider the advice of a professional before you commence with any unique floor plans to suit your requirements.
